|  | What Your Child Needs to Succeed
There’s no secret to getting a high score on the SAT or ACT,
but there are many ways you can help your teen prepare for the
test(s). By encouraging your teen to take challenging courses,
get familiar with the test formats, and research college
requirements you’ll increase her chances of scoring well when
test time arrives.
